The Geography of Spin Symplectic 4-Manifolds

Abstract

In this paper we construct a family of simply connected, spin, non-complex, symplectic 4-manifolds which cover all but finitely many allowed lattice points (, c) lying in 0 ≤ c ≤ 8.76. Furthermore, as a corollary, we prove that there exist infinitely many exotic smooth structures on (2n+1)(S2 × S2) for all n large enough.
